@BamaStateSB rebounds with win over Delaware State

Lady Hornets use 13 hits to run to victory in second game of day

ACWORTH, Ga. | Alabama State pounded out 13 hits and had four players with multiple hits as the Lady Hornets ran past Delaware State, 9-5, in the second game of the day of the HBCU Tournament at Patriot Park.

Alabama State (9-9) used seven runs combined in the first two innings Saturday to run out to a 7-0 lead, and pushed the lead 8-0 before Delaware State was able to get on the board. The Lady Hornets a two-run double from Kristin Gunter to get on the board early, after a walk to Kaylee Davis and a single from Alexis Sydnor, for the 2-0 lead. They pushed the lead to 3-0 in the first when Charlene Castro singled to score Gunter for the final run of the inning.

The Lady Hornets added four more in the second when Gunter reached on an infield single to score Davis for the second time on the day. The lead was pushed to 5-0 when Castro recorded another RBI single, followed by an RBI single from Vanessa Bradford to push the lead to 6-0. The game was put out of reach when Alexis Massie recorded a sacrifice fly for the 7-0 lead.

Castro led the way at the plate for the Lady Hornets as she went 3-for-4 with a run scored and three runs batted in, while Sydnor finished 3-for-5 with three runs scored. Bradford finished 3-for-3 with an RBI, and Gunter 2-for-3 with three runs batted in a pair of runs scored.

Bradford got the win on the mound, logging 4.2 innings and allowing three runs (two earned) off of four hits with five strikeouts. Castro came in to finish off the game with 2.1 innings pitched and allowed two runs (no earned) off of two hits, with a pair of strikeouts.
